Propellerhead releases Instrument Development Toolkit for Rack Extensions

-
Reason Studios

Propellerhead has announced that the new Instrument Development Toolkit (IDT) for Rack Extensions is now available, making it easy for sample library producers and instrument designers to build and sell Rack Extensions for the Reason platform. The new toolkit enables developers to create instruments and bring them to market with minimum effort and maximum support.

"We created the Propellerhead Rack Extension plug-in platform to enable developers to go from initial idea to completed selling product faster and easier, " stated Mats Karlöf, Manager Third Party Developer Relations. "Now, with the Instrument Development Toolkit, it's easy to build powerful Rack Extension instruments for Reason, even without prior coding experience. The recently released A-List series and Jiggery Pokery instruments demonstrate that developers can easily create Rack Extensions that sound incredible and work flawlessly within Reason."

The new Instrument Development Toolkit makes it possible for developers to easily build professional sample-based instruments without writing C++ code. Current Kontakt and NN-XT instrument designers can import their libraries into IDT, greatly accelerating the process of developing instruments. IDT's vast built-in effect library, full-featured sampler engine, flexibility and powerful scripting language facilitate the creation of one-of-a-kind instruments.
